Energy efficiency

Double glazed windows can make your home more energy efficient. They will keep your home warm in winter and cool in the summer. They can also help you reduce your utility bills. These windows can save you up to 12% off your energy bills each year.

A double glazed window is one that has two panes of glass that are hermetically sealed. Each pane is separated by a spacer, and the space is then filled with an inert gas (usually argon or krypton). These gases act as insulation, keeping warm air inside your home. Double-glazed windows are more efficient than single-paned windows.

The frame material, the size and the type of glazing are all elements that can influence the energy efficiency. For example, uPVC frames are more energy efficient than timber and aluminium. Also, the argon or krypton gas filling the gap between the glass panes could significantly reduce your energy bills.

Security

Double glazing will make it harder for burglars to gain entry into your home. This is because single glass panes as well as aluminium or timber windows can be smashed easily by opportunistic, or professional thieves. double glazing companies near me glazing is made up of two panes of glass and locking mechanisms that are significantly more resistant to break. This makes it much harder for burglars to gain entry to your home or property and prevents them from taking valuable items and damaging your property.

Double glazed windows are made out of two glass panes with a gap between them and are sealed inside a unit called an IGU (insulated glazing unit). The glass is laminated or tempered for strength and the gap is filled with air or, more commonly, the gas argon. It is a non-toxic, odourless gas that has insulating properties.

There are a myriad of alternatives for glass, such as tints, UV blockers, and low-e films that are energy-efficient. You can upgrade to toughened safety glass that is up to five times stronger than standard glass and reduces chance of injury in case of a break particularly for children.
